Canon G11 vs Canon SD4000 IS Overview

Following is a extended review of the Canon G11 versus Canon SD4000 IS, both Small Sensor Compact digital cameras and both are offered by Canon. The image resolution of the G11 (10MP) and the SD4000 IS (10MP) is very well matched but the G11 (1/1.7") and SD4000 IS (1/2.3") offer totally different sensor measurements.

Canon G11 vs Canon SD4000 IS Physical Comparison

In case you're looking to carry around your camera, you need to take into account its weight and size. The Canon G11 provides outer measurements of 112mm x 76mm x 48mm (4.4" x 3.0" x 1.9") with a weight of 375 grams (0.83 lbs) whilst the Canon SD4000 IS has specifications of 100mm x 54mm x 23mm (3.9" x 2.1" x 0.9") along with a weight of 175 grams (0.39 lbs).

Canon G11 vs Canon SD4000 IS Sensor Comparison

Sometimes, it can be difficult to envision the difference between sensor sizes simply by looking at specs. The picture below should give you a much better sense of the sensor sizing in the G11 and SD4000 IS.

As you can plainly see, both of those cameras come with the identical megapixels but not the same sensor sizes. The G11 features the larger sensor which is going to make getting shallow depth of field simpler. The more aged G11 is going to be behind in sensor innovation.
